INSIGHT

Megalodon's Hunting Evidence

  • Fossil whale bones with megalodon bite marks prove it was an effective ambush predator.
  • Megalodon attacked whales even head-on, demonstrating powerful jaws and hunting strategies.
ANECDOTE

Catalina Pimiento's Megalodon Research

  • Professor Catalina Pimiento, an expert on megalodon, found average megalodons were around 12-13m and gave birth to pups 2.5m long.
  • Recent studies show megalodon was warm-blooded, about 28°C, supporting active predation.
INSIGHT

Rich Ecosystem of Megalodon's Era

  • Megalodon's ocean environment was rich with large marine mammals, seabirds, and competing giant sharks.
  • This high biomass fueled an intense predator-rich ecosystem during megalodon's reign.
